| (from Chris Adolfsen. Garth wonders should this be a calibration attribute rather than physics interface?) Slow tuner start-up position prior to rf turn on - with the piezo voltages zeroed, the cavity would be tuned close to 1.3 GHz after the operating gradient is established - thus the initial detuning with rf off relative to 1.3 GHz is K*(operating gradient)^2 |

Signal calibration. For SRF cavities, the PVs below are provided for CAV, FWD, REV, DRV signals. The SRF PV name examples below use CAV. |
Measured values |
R/W | <SIG>:CAL_ADC_10DBM | ADC counts at 10 dBm. EPICS software uses this to calculate RF power at full scale. | ACCL:L1B:0210:CAV:CAL_ADC_10DBM |
|
R/W | <SIG>:CAL_LOSS_CABLE | Measured cable losses used in signal calibration. Positive value in dB. | ACCL:L1B:0210:CAV:CAL_LOSS_CABLE |
|
R/W | <SIG>:CAL_LOSS_CPLR | Measured coupler loss used in signal calibration. Positive value in dB. | ACCL:L1B:0210:CAV:CAL_LOSS_CPLR |
|
R/W | <SIG>:CAL_LOSS_ATTEN | Fixed attenuator used in signal calibration. Positive value in dB. | ACCL:L1B:0210:CAV:CAL_LOSS_ATTEN |
|
R/W | <SIG>:CAL_LOSS_OTHER | Unattributed measured loss used in signal calibration. Positive value in dB. | ACCL:L1B:0210:CAV:CAL_LOSS_OTHER |
|
EPICS-calculated values |
R | <SIG>:CAL_REF_PWR | RF power at ADC full scale. [dBm] | ACCL:L1B:0210:CAV:CAL_REF_PWR |
|
R | <SIG>:CAL_LOSS_TOTAL | Total (of cable, coupler, atten, other) loss used in signal calibration. Positive value in dB. | ACCL:L1B:0210:CAV:CAL_LOSS_TOTAL |
|
R | <SIG>:SCALE | Final calibration scale factor to convert raw ADC counts to amplitude. This also include the beam-based fudge factor | ACCL:L1B:0210:CAV:SCALE |
|
For SRF, the signal calibration for Cavity Probe (CAV) can be calculated 2 ways: (1) using the above system losses, power at ADC full scale, and cavity probe Q or (2) calculated from the reverse signal decay. Experts can choose which method they would like to use per cavity |
R/W | CAVSCALE_SEL | Select between calibration methods: 0 = Qprobe, 1 = RevCal | ACCL:L1B:0210:CAVSCALE_SEL |
|
R/W | QPROBE | Cavity probe Q. Used in Qprobe calibration method. | ACCL:L1B:0210:QPROBE |
